bdm::ARXAgent Class Reference
ARX agent. More...
#include <arx_agent.h>
Inheritance diagram for bdm::ARXAgent:
Public Member Functions | |
void | validate () |
void | receive (const Setting &msg) |
void | broadcast (Setting &set) |
void | adapt (const vec &glob_dt) |
void | act (vec &glob_ut) |
virtual void | ds_register (const DS &ds) |
void | from_setting (const Setting &set) |
Protected Attributes | |
Array< string > | neighbours |
Pointers to neighbours. | |
shared_ptr< LQG_ARX > | lqg_arx |
Internal ARX Controller. | |
shared_ptr< merger_mix > | merger |
Merger for predictors from neighbours. | |
Array< shared_ptr< pdf > > | preds |
All available predictors. | |
mlnorm_chmat_ptr | my_pred |
My own predictor. | |
datalink_part | dlU |
data link of data | |
datalink_buffered | dlDt |
data link of | |
vec | dt |
internal data vector for controller | |
vec | ut |
internal data vector for controller output |
Detailed Description
ARX agent.
The documentation for this class was generated from the following file:
Generated on 2 Dec 2013 for mixpp by 1.4.7